Pennsylvania’s Bold Leap: A Bill to Position Bitcoin as a State Reserve Asset
Introduction:
In a groundbreaking move, the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ania has introduced legislation titled the “Pennsylvania Bitcoin Strategic Reserve Act,” aiming to allocate a portion of the state’s financial reserves into Bitcoin. This initiative marks Pennsylvania as a potential trailblazer in the integration of digital assets into traditional state financial strategies, reflecting a broader trend of recognizing cryptocurrencies as viable stores of value.
The Bill’s Journey:
The bill was introduced by Republican State Representative Mike Cabell, who has long been an advocate for cryptocurrency. The legislation proposes that up to 10% of Pennsylvania’s state funds, which could amount to approximately $7 billion, be invested in Bitcoin. This move is intended as a hedge against inflation and a diversification from traditional reserve assets like bonds and cash.
Economic Rationale:
- Inflation Hedge: Advocates for the bill argue that Bitcoin’s limited supply could serve as an effective countermeasure against inflation, which traditional currencies frequently face.
- Financial Innovation: The introduction of Bitcoin into state reserves is seen as a step towards financial resilience and innovation, positioning Pennsylvania at the forefront of modern financial management practices.
- Portfolio Diversification: By including Bitcoin, Pennsylvania seeks to diversify its investment portfolio beyond conventional assets, potentially reducing risk and enhancing returns over time.
Political and Public Reaction:
- Bipartisan Support: The bill has garnered attention for its bipartisan support. Despite the polarized political climate, both Democrats and Republicans have shown interest in the potential benefits of integrating digital assets into state financial strategies.
- Public Sentiment on X: Posts on X (formerly known as Twitter) reflect a mix of excitement and skepticism. While some users applaud Pennsylvania for its progressive financial policy, others express concerns over the volatility and regulatory ambiguity surrounding cryptocurrencies.
- Federal Context: This state-level initiative comes at a time when the federal government is still grappling with how to regulate digital assets. Pennsylvania’s move could influence national discussions on the role of cryptocurrencies in public finance.
Potential Implications:
- Precedent Setting: If passed, Pennsylvania could set a precedent for other states, potentially encouraging a national shift towards recognizing cryptocurrencies in state financial planning.
- Market Impact: The legislation might boost Bitcoin’s market perception as a legitimate asset class, possibly influencing its price and adoption rate.
- Regulatory Clarity: The push for Bitcoin reserves might accelerate the need for clearer federal regulations concerning digital assets, given the significant public funds involved.
Challenges and Criticisms:
- Volatility: Critics point to Bitcoin’s price volatility as a significant risk for state funds.
- Security Concerns: Holding large amounts of Bitcoin requires robust cybersecurity measures to prevent theft or loss.
- Legal and Regulatory Hurdles: The lack of comprehensive federal guidelines on cryptocurrencies could complicate the implementation of such a policy.

Market Consolidation with Selective Gainers Amid 350+ Tokens Declining

Altcoin Market Shows Bifurcation as Broader Sell-Off Continues
The cryptocurrency market entered a phase of consolidation on May 19, 2026, with over 350 tokens posting losses in the past 24 hours while a handful of selective altcoins delivered strong double-digit gains. This divergence highlights ongoing rotation, profit-taking in weaker assets, and targeted interest in projects with strong narratives or technical setups amid overall market caution.
Standout Gainers in a Sea of Red
Bonfida (FIDA) led the charge with gains exceeding +38% in the last day, driven by heightened trading activity and ecosystem developments on Solana. Other notable performers included KDA (Kadena) and several mid-cap tokens posting 15–30% moves, reflecting speculative interest in select narratives.
Zcash (ZEC) also featured prominently, climbing over 7% in recent sessions and drawing analyst attention for its privacy-focused fundamentals. Hyperliquid’s HYPE token continued to attract bullish commentary, with analysts citing robust on-chain revenue, perpetuals trading dominance, and potential ETF inflows as reasons for its resilience.
Sharp Losses for Underperformers
On the downside, the broader market felt the pressure. Acala (ACA) suffered one of the steepest drops, plunging approximately -51%, as low-liquidity tokens faced accelerated selling. Many smaller and mid-tier projects saw 10–30% declines, contributing to the wide breadth of losers.
Bitcoin Cash (BCH) broke decisively below the key $400 psychological level, trading around $360–$380 in recent hours. The move has sparked discussions of further downside risk, with technical analysts pointing to weakened momentum and failure to hold long-term support zones.
Analyst Highlights and Market Context
Analysts have named Hyperliquid (HYPE) and Zcash (ZEC) among their top picks for May and beyond. Reasons include:
- Hyperliquid: Strong fee generation from decentralized perpetuals trading, innovative tokenomics (including buybacks), and growing institutional interest.
- Zcash: Renewed focus on privacy amid increasing blockchain surveillance concerns, combined with favorable technical setups.
Bitcoin dominance remains elevated near 60%, underscoring the ongoing “flight to quality” where capital concentrates in established assets while altcoins experience selective outperformance. Total crypto market capitalization hovered near $2.57 trillion with modest daily movement.
